The goal of this training book is to provide students with the knowledge and skills necessary to effectively manage projects using Microsoft Project Desktop (2010, 2013 & 2016). TARGET AUDIENCE This training book is intended for Project Managers, Project Schedulers, Managers, Supervisors, Team Leads and other people responsible for managing projects. These individuals are involved in or responsible for scheduling, estimating, coordinating, controlling, budgeting and staffing of projects and supporting other users of Microsoft Project. COURSE OUTLINE Module 1: Overview of Microsoft Project Lesson 1: What's New in Project? Lesson 2: Backstage Area Lesson 3: The Ribbon Lesson 4: Project Views Module 2: Configure Project Settings Lesson 1: Configuring Display and Schedule Settings Lesson 2: Creating and Configuring Calendars Lesson 3: Creating and Saving a Project Schedule Lesson 4: Scheduling Types Module 3: Working with Tasks Lesson 1: Managing Tasks and the WBS Lesson 2: Working with Task Dependencies Lesson 3: Working with Constraints Lesson 4: Advanced Task Features Module 4: Working with Resources Lesson 1: Resource Types Lesson 2: Creating Resources Module 5: Assigning and Leveling Work Resources Lesson 1: Working with Resource Assignments Lesson 2: Factors that Affect Assignments Lesson 3: Viewing Resource Assignments Lesson 4: Resolving Resource Allocations Module 6: Finalizing the Project Schedule Lesson 1: Understanding the Critical Path Method Lesson 2: Working with Groups, Filters and Highlights Lesson 3: Setting the Project Baseline Module 7: Tracking and Updating Project Schedules Lesson 1: Overview of Tracking the Project Schedule Lesson 2: Tracking Project Progress Lesson 3: Updating Project Progress Module 8: Working with Advanced Features Lesson 1: Linking Multiple Project Schedules Lesson 2: Working with Master and Subprojects Lesson 3: Working with Resource Pools Lesson 4: Integrating with Microsoft Excel and SharePoint AT COMPLETION After completing this training book, you will be able to: * Understand the new user interface of Microsoft Project. * Initialize Microsoft Project settings. * Create a Work Breakdown Structure (WBS). * Create task relationships in a project schedule. * Configure advanced task information. * Use the Task Inspector. * Create and manage resources. * Assign and level work resources. * Review and finalize the project schedule. * Track and update project schedules. * Manage multiple projects and resource pools. PREREQUISITES You should have a working knowledge of the following: * Microsoft Windows Server 20xx networking. * Basic project management concepts. SOFTWARE REQUIREMENTS In order to complete the hands-on practices in this course you will require the following software: * Microsoft Project Standard or Microsoft Project Professional * Any version between 2010 - 2016 * Microsoft Excel * Any version between 2010 - 2016 TRAINING FILES Additional training files (PowerPoint slides, LabFiles and Hyper-V Build Guides) can be downloaded from our website at http://www.learnmsproject.ca/support/training-files/
